AnchorMAN Wireless Intercom System

It's time for a change in the intercom world of base stations and overly complicated operation. The AnchorMAN is a new wireless intercom system that provides unprecedented ease of use and flexibility.

After months of concept, design and finally FCC approval, the AnchorMAN Wireless Intercom System is now available. The patent pending AnchorMAN has ergonomically styled belt packs that are lightweight and user friendly. Once you experience the ease of use and see the competitive pricing, you'll want an AnchorMAN for yourself. The AnchorMAN is here.

Features
  • There is no base station but the functionality of a base station is not abandoned. AnchorMAN belt packs talk directly to one another.
  • The system is expandable - just purchase additional belt packs.
  • The signal beats the competition. Unlike 2.4 MHz products, AnchorMAN operates with a longer wave signal that can pass through most walls in duplex mode up to 250 feet.
  • In duplex mode each belt pack can listen and speak to four belt packs at one time.
  • Just when a 2.4 MHz looses signal, the AnchorMAN automatically switches to simplex mode to boost the range to about 2500 feet.
  • Simplex Mode refers to the range at which you can listen to another speaker without your transmitter on. If you are having difficulty hearing someone, let go of the PTT button and listen up.
  • Belt packs are comfortable to wear and are made of rugged materials. Buttons are clearly labeled and operation is logical and easy.
  • Operates on four rechargeable NiMH batteries - up to 7 hours in receive mode and 3 hours in continuous transmit.
  • No complex set up or tuning is needed. Compatible frequency planning and selection are performed in the Anchor factory.
  • Hands free operation is offered by using the voice activation feature. Just adjust the microphone sensitivity on the side of the belt pack for your environment. Now just speak into the dynamic microphone to activate transmission.
  • State of the art electronics and software developed for AnchorMAN allows for breakthrough pricing.
  • Churches, small theaters, athletic departments and other budget conscious customers can enjoy high performance wireless intercom features for the price of the most antiquated wired systems.

What Is AnchorMAN?

The AnchorMAN is a new wireless intercom system that provides unprecedented ease of use and flexibility. The MAN in AnchorMAN stands for Mobile Audio Network. Designed for portability, it requires no base station. However, the functionality of a base station is not abandoned. Each belt pack is capable of listening to 4 belt packs at one time. Compatible frequency groups are pre-selected to allow operation in up to four separate groups with no interference.

How Does It Work?

There are two ranges specified for the BP-900 - Simplex & Duplex. Simplex Range refers to the distance at which you can listen to another speaker without your transmitter on. We have achieved an excellent Simplex Range of up to 2500'. Duplex Range is the distance at which you can listen to another speaker while you are also transmitting. The specified Duplex Range is 250'. When belt packs venture beyond their Duplex Range, operation automatically converts to Simplex.

Is It Dependable?

One of the goals for the AnchorMAN was to design a system that is not only efficient to build, but easy to build consistently. Quality control is maintained by proprietary, automated testing and calibration algorithms that ensure each belt pack is tested against a tightly controlled standard.

How Easy Is AnchorMAN To Use?

AnchorMAN is easy to use and does not require a sixty page manual to operate. Set your group selections, the microphone sensitivity and the headset volume and you are ready to begin using AnchorMAN.
